As I was studying the book of Revelation it occurs to me we have only been skimming the surface re. the Mark of the Beast. The Bible tells us the mark will be on either the forehead of the hand. In the Bible the forehead seems to symbolize the mind, how we think, our fundamental philosophy and paradigm. (Romans
7:25; Ezekiel 3:8,9; Rev 7:3; Eph 1:22, Gen 24:26; Ex 34:8; Dan 4:5-10; Oba 1:15; Matt
21:42; 1 Cor 11:3; Eph 4:15; Col 2:19; ) The hand seems to symbolize our work, what we do, our actions. (Gen 3:22, 4:11, 14:22; Ex 4:20; Psa 144:11; Matt
8:3; Mark 14:42; Luke 6:10; Acts 9:12)
My thinking is that the head (our fundamental philosophy and thinking) show in what we do, the work of our hands. This does not negate an actual mark but does indicate the spirit of the Anti-Christ has been with us since Eve was first deceived and sinned and Adam also sinned. This is consistent with John's writings (1 John 2:18, 2:22, 4:3; 2 John 1:7).
I realize this is not new, many Bible students have had these same thought. The difference it makes to me is the realization we are emphasizing the mark and not recognizing what causes that mark, what will drive people to take that mark. The driver is the fact those who accept the mark had the spirit of the antichrist already working in them. The problem comes with those who take the mark not realizing what it truly signifies. Will some Christians take the mark because they do not know the Holy Scriptures and are not cognizant of Satan's tricks, or are concerned with their survival?

Sir Francis Bacon (and others)
I have often heard it said that the early scientists, the first to use actual experiments, 'proved' there is no God. On the contrary, many of these people had a strong belief in a Creator. Specifically, a personality who created everything putting into place certain laws that govern how all things work and work together. If these experimenters did not believe that there would be no sense in experimenting since the results of each experiment would be random, based on pure chance. Chaos does not breed order and structure, it only breeds more chaos.

Eternity
A friend made the comment today that it does not quite seem fair that we are condemned to Hell or be taken to Heaven for eternity when we die. My friend is a Christian but he said consigning a person to either for eternity does not seem fair.
My response was that we do not understand eternity, nor are we truly capable of understanding it. We look at eternity as a period of time but eternity is the absence of time. Time is for us, God does not dwell in time and, after we die, neither do we.
The other thought is that God does not condemn us to Hell. We make the choice during our lives and God simply honors our choice. We decide where we want to spend eternity. God does and has done everything to show and convince us to accept Christ. It is our choice to do so.
